There was no shortage of high-fashion drama on theAcademy Awards red carpeton Sunday night. Fromradiant red lookstovoluminous silhouettestoZendaya’s abs, stars were more than happy to make a grand return to theOscars spotlightin a variety of show-stopping styles.
And of course, one look isneverenough. The night’s biggest winners and best dressed stars made sure to switch up their ensembles forthe Oscars' afterparty circuit, delivering even more mic-drop fashion moments. (Don’t forget to check out100+ best looks from Oscars weekend).
Below, see 10 amazing ceremony-to-afterpary outfit transformations that have PEOPLE style editors talking — and read about ourfavorite looks of the night right here.
Jada Pinkett Smith
Getty (2)

Oscars Red Carpet:commanded the carpet in a dazzling Jean Paul Gaultier SS22 Couture gowncomplete with a high neck, ruched bodice, drop waist and dramatic ruffled skirt, plus matching Jimmy choo heels and G Jewels bling.
Vanity FairAfterparty: switches into a custom gold gradient Dolce & Gabbana strapless gown entirely beaded with Swarovski crystals and a silk chiffon cape.
Jessica Chastain

Oscars Red Carpet: in asequin ombré Gucci gownand statement lionhead diamond-and-white gold earrings, plus a bracelet from Gucci’s High Jewelry collection.
Vanity FairAfterparty: goes for Gucci again in a custom emerald lamé draped gown with pleated detailing and a bustier bodice, plus bling from Gucci’s High Jewelry collection.
